Leptoplesictis namibiensis Morales et al. 2008 (civet)

Mammalia - Carnivora - Viverridae

Full reference: J. Morales, M. Pickford, and M. J. Salesa. 2008. Creodonta and Carnivora from the Early Miocene of the Northern Sperrgebiet, Namibia. Memoir of the Geological Survey of Namibia 20:291-310

Belongs to Leptoplesictis according to J. Morales et al. 2008

Sister taxon: Leptoplesictis senutae

Type specimen: LT 50’07, a tooth (right m/1). Its type locality is Langental, which is in a Miocene terrestrial marl in Namibia.

Ecology: scansorial carnivore-insectivore

Distribution: found only at Langental
